Role: Full Stack Java Developer
Start: January 2026
Duration: 12 months (inside IR35)
Location: Bournemouth (Hybrid)
This is an exciting opportunity to join a leading Tier 1 global investment bank on a large-scale technology programme.
Overview
We are supporting a premier investment banking client with an urgent requirement for multiple Full Stack Java Developers to join a high-performing engineering team in Bournemouth. The programme is long-term business-critical and offers exposure to complex enterprise-scale systems.
The Role
The client is seeking a blend of Senior/Lead-level and MidSenior Full Stack Java Developers to support the design development and enhancement of core platforms. You will work closely with engineering architecture and product teams to deliver robust scalable solutions.
Design develop and maintain high-quality Java-based applications
Build and enhance microservices using Spring Boot
Contribute across the full software development lifecycle
Collaborate with front-end developers using ReactJS where required
Write clean maintainable and well-tested code
Participate in code reviews and technical discussions
Support production issues and continuous improvement initiatives
Senior/Lead-level candidates will also provide technical guidance and mentoring
Strong Core Java development experience (essential)
Full Stack experience including exposure to ReactJS
Advanced experience with Spring / Spring Boot
A mix of Full Stack and Core Java specialists can be considered
Senior / Lead level: 710 years experience
MidSenior level: 46 years experience
IT Services and IT Consulting